On 17 January 2023, the Black Book of Russian War Crimes: Facts of Genocide discussion was held in Davos (Switzerland) on the occasion of the World Economic Forum. The event was held within the Ukraine Is You project organized by the Victor Pinchuk Foundation, PinchukArtCentre in cooperation with the Office of the President of Ukraine. The project brings together global thinkers, experts and people from the ground in Ukraine to discuss the assault on the country, Russian war crimes and also the hope and empowerment of defending freedom and independence.

17 January 2023, Davos: Victor Pinchuk Foundation and PinchukArtCentre, in cooperation with the Office of the President of Ukraine, today opened the UKRAINE IS YOU project, on the occasion of the World Economic Forum 2023. The project showcases Ukrainians defending freedom in the face of Russian aggression.

President of Ukraine, Volodymyr Zelenskyy will address the audience via video-link.
On January 19, 2023 in Davos (Switzerland), the Victor Pinchuk Foundation, and international investment advisory group EastOne, will host the annual Ukrainian Breakfast Discussion, their traditional ‘closed’ event, which takes place on the occasion of the Annual Meeting of the World Economic Forum (WEF). The discussion, which will focus on the most urgent issues facing Ukraine, will be moderated by Fareed Zakaria, host of Fareed Zakaria GPS on CNN.
